news 2026/4/25 9:50:38

Devbox自动化环境配置:3步打造完美开发环境

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Devbox自动化环境配置:3步打造完美开发环境

Devbox自动化环境配置:3步打造完美开发环境

【免费下载链接】devboxInstant, easy, and predictable development environments项目地址: https://gitcode.com/GitHub_Trending/dev/devbox

还在为开发环境配置而烦恼吗?Devbox自动化环境配置工具让这一切变得简单高效!作为一款智能化的开发环境管理解决方案,Devbox能够根据项目特征自动生成最优配置,确保团队成员在不同设备上获得完全一致的编码体验。✨

为什么开发者需要Devbox?

传统开发环境搭建往往面临诸多痛点:依赖版本冲突、环境配置复杂、团队协作困难。Devbox通过智能分析自动化配置,彻底解决了这些长期困扰开发者的问题。

核心价值亮点:

  • 🚀极速启动:新成员5分钟内即可投入开发工作
  • 🔧智能识别:自动检测项目类型和所需工具链
  • 📦依赖管理:自动解决包依赖和版本冲突
  • 🔄环境一致性:确保开发、测试、生产环境完全同步

Devbox自动化配置的三大优势

1. 智能项目分析

Devbox通过扫描项目中的关键配置文件,深度理解项目需求:

  • 语言配置文件(package.json、go.mod、requirements.txt等)
  • 构建工具配置
  • 运行时环境要求
  • 开发工具依赖

2. 多环境支持

无论是前端项目、后端服务还是全栈应用,Devbox都能提供精准的环境配置。支持的技术栈包括:

  • Node.js 前端开发
  • Python 数据科学
  • Go 后端服务
  • 各类数据库和中间件

3. 团队协作标准化

新成员加入团队时,只需执行简单命令:

git clone https://gitcode.com/GitHub_Trending/dev/devbox devbox shell

立即获得与团队其他成员完全一致的开发环境。

快速上手:3步搭建开发环境

第一步:项目初始化

在项目根目录运行初始化命令,Devbox会自动扫描项目结构并生成基础配置文件。

第二步:环境配置优化

Devbox根据项目特征自动选择最适合的工具版本和配置参数,确保开发环境的最佳性能。

第三步:启动开发工作

使用devbox shell命令进入配置好的开发环境,所有必要的工具和依赖都会自动可用。

高级功能深度解析

多项目管理解决方案

同时处理多个项目时,Devbox确保每个项目都有独立、隔离的环境,彻底避免依赖冲突问题。

插件系统扩展能力

丰富的插件生态让Devbox功能无限扩展。无论是特定开发工具还是自定义配置,都能通过插件系统轻松实现。

实际应用场景展示

团队开发标准化流程

通过Devbox的自动化配置,团队可以建立统一的开发环境标准,大幅提升协作效率。

个人开发者效率提升

独立开发者可以利用Devbox快速切换不同项目环境,专注于编码创新而非环境维护。

最佳实践指南

  1. 配置文件版本控制:将devbox.json和devbox.lock纳入版本管理
  2. 定期环境更新:使用devbox update保持工具链最新
  3. 充分利用插件:探索官方插件库,发现更多实用功能

技术架构解析

Devbox采用现代化的技术架构设计,核心组件包括:

  • 智能检测模块:自动识别项目技术栈
  • 依赖解析引擎:智能解决版本冲突
  • 环境隔离层:确保项目间完全独立

总结与展望

Devbox自动化环境配置工具重新定义了开发环境搭建的方式。通过智能分析和自动配置,它让开发者能够专注于核心业务逻辑,彻底告别环境配置的繁琐工作。

无论你是独立开发者还是团队协作,Devbox都能提供稳定、一致、高效的开发体验。立即开始使用,拥抱真正的可复现开发工作流!🎯

【免费下载链接】devboxInstant, easy, and predictable development environments项目地址: https://gitcode.com/GitHub_Trending/dev/devbox

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 6:25:44

DeepSeek LLM大语言模型完整入门指南:从零开始掌握开源AI利器

DeepSeek LLM大语言模型完整入门指南:从零开始掌握开源AI利器 【免费下载链接】DeepSeek-LLM DeepSeek LLM: Let there be answers 项目地址: https://gitcode.com/GitHub_Trending/de/DeepSeek-LLM 还在为选择合适的大语言模型而烦恼吗?DeepSeek…

作者头像 李华
网站建设 2026/4/23 12:40:36

为什么选择Stockfish.js作为你的Web象棋引擎和浏览器AI解决方案

为什么选择Stockfish.js作为你的Web象棋引擎和浏览器AI解决方案 【免费下载链接】stockfish.js The Stockfish chess engine in Javascript 项目地址: https://gitcode.com/gh_mirrors/st/stockfish.js 在开发在线对弈系统时,你是否曾面临这样的困境&#xf…

作者头像 李华
网站建设 2026/4/24 20:27:55

BizHawk多系统模拟器完整使用指南:5分钟快速上手配置教程

BizHawk多系统模拟器完整使用指南:5分钟快速上手配置教程 【免费下载链接】BizHawk BizHawk is a multi-system emulator written in C#. BizHawk provides nice features for casual gamers such as full screen, and joypad support in addition to full rerecord…

作者头像 李华